    SB without server-side software? A SB controller /= IRremote?

    Running the SB without slimserver/equivalent is possible? I believe that I
    found a post that said it was, but there were issues that needed to be
    considered.
    Reason I ask is because I [will] have a storage device that is incapable of
    running the software. It has a MAC and IP and its possible to share a playlist
    on the disk. (Its called Aireo2 if you are interested)

    Second question: Are there other options as to controlling the device much
    like how you would control it with the remote (i.e. simple buttons) other than
    a computer interface?
    I would like to hide the SB and control it from my car's HU. I can build an
    adaptor but would much rather find out if someone "invented that wheel" first.

    The Omnifi DMP1 is going to be a better automotive solution for a number of reasons. Not the least of which being that the Squeezebox absolutely needs slimserver in order to work. Virtually every single action of the squeezebox is explicitly controlled by slimserver: everything that the squeezebox displays, and all its behavior and sound is impossible without slimserver. The squeezebox is dumb by itself.

    The DMP1 is built with a good interface with interacting with your music, and already conquers the turn-on/shut-down problems inherent in car setups. Additionally, it's able to synchronize with your pc via wireless while your car sits outside. As much as I love the squeezebox, getting it to work well in a car setup could be a nightmare (also consider that every time a squeezebox loses, then recovers power it goes through its network setup routine).
